Industrial Nickel Form Analysis & Applications
This vital industrial metal is widely used in stainless steel across North Macedonia. As green energy projects grows, the appetite for durable nickel is reaching new heights. Monitoring the price of Nickel per 1 Scrap Nickel Lb enables battery makers to predict market shifts with high precision.
Roughly 70% of all Nickel is used to produce stainless steel. It enhances the metal's formability, weldability, and resistance to corrosion.
The fastest-growing segment for Class 1 Nickel is battery manufacturing, particularly for NMC and NCA EV batteries, boosting energy density and driving range.
